Rhetorical devices

Michelle Zauner uses several rhetorical devices in her article “Ever since my mom died, I cry in H Mart”. These devices serve to make the reader become familiar with aspects of Korean culture, especially related to food. They also highlight the author’s grief and her feeling that she has lost a part of her identity. 

Anecdotes

Towards the end of the article, Zauner presents a short anecdote about a Korean boy and his mother, who sit next to Zauner at the H Mart food court (ll. 97-106). Zauner seems to see something of her own relationship with her mother in their interactions, and she would like to tell the boy to appreciate his mother because life is short.
